Newly Discovered Pathway Might Help in Design of Cancer Drugs

Johns Hopkins chemists have discovered a new way to sabotage DNA's ability to reproduce, a finding that could eventually lead to the development of new anti-cancer drugs and therapies.The method could enable future doctors to target treatment more precisely, rather than directing chemotherapeutic medication or radiation to tumors through a scattershot approach, said Marc Greenberg (pictured at right), a chemistry professor in the university's Zanvyl Krieger School of Arts and Sciences, who presented his team's findings today at the 229th American Chemical Society Meeting in San Diego.
